BODY {background-image:url(../images/texture.gif); background-attachment:fixed; background-color:#B8B3A5; scrollbar-face-color: #99948E ; scrollbar-shadow-color: #B8B3A5;
scrollbar-highlight-color: #B8B3A5 ; scrollbar-3dlight-color: #B8B3A5; scrollbar-darkshadow-color: #B8B3A5; scrollbar-track-color: #B8B3A5; scrollbar-arrow-color: #000000}

div#FixDivH {position:absolute;top: expression(documentElement.scrollTop+body.scrollTop +0 + "px");width:expression(document.body.clientWidth - 0 + "px");}
html>body div#FixDivH { position: fixed; top:0px;}
html[xmlns] div#FixDivH { position: fixed; top:0px;}
div#FixDivG {position:absolute;top:expression(documentElement.scrollTop+body.scrollTop +110 + "px");height:expression(documentElement.scrollTop+body.scrollTop - 150 + "px");}
html>body div#FixDivG { position: fixed; top:110px;}
html[xmlns] div#FixDivG { position: fixed; top:110px;}
div#FixDivM {overflow: auto;position:absolute;top:expression(110 + "px");width:expression(document.body.clientWidth - 400 + "px");height:expression(document.body.clientHeight - 150 + "px");}
html>body div#FixDivM {position:fixed; top:110px; bottom:45px;}
html[xmlns] div#FixDivM {position:fixed; top:110px; bottom:45px;}
div#FixDivB {position:absolute;top:expression(body.scrollTop + document.body.clientHeight - 40 + "px");width:expression(document.body.clientWidth - 0 + "px");}
html>body div#FixDivB { position:fixed;bottom:0px;}
html[xmlns] div#FixDivB { position:fixed;bottom:0px;}
div#FixImage {position:absolute;top: expression(110 + "px");width: expression(document.body.clientWidth - 0 + "px");height: expression(document.body.clientHeight - 145 + "px");}
html>body div#FixImage {position:fixed; top:110px; bottom:40px;}
html[xmlns] div#FixImage {position:fixed; top:110px; bottom:40px;}


.asc {scrollbar-face-color: #B8B3A5 ; scrollbar-shadow-color: #B8B3A5;
scrollbar-highlight-color: #B8B3A5 ; scrollbar-3dlight-color: #B8B3A5; scrollbar-darkshadow-color: #B8B3A5; scrollbar-track-color: #B8B3A5; scrollbar-arrow-color: #99948E}


.fond {background-image:  url(images/fondmil.gif); background-repeat: repeat-y}

.partenaires {
scrollbar-face-color: #B3AEA1 ; scrollbar-shadow-color: #B8B3A5;
scrollbar-highlight-color: #B8B3A5 ; scrollbar-3dlight-color: #B8B3A5; scrollbar-darkshadow-color: #B8B3A5; scrollbar-track-color: #B8B3A5; scrollbar-arrow-color: #000000
}

.texte {FONT-SIZE: 10pt; COLOR: #A2874F; FONT-FAMILY: Verdana; TEXT-DECORATION: none; line-height:14px;}
A.texte:hover {FONT-SIZE: 10pt; COLOR: #FFFF00; FONT-FAMILY: Verdana; TEXT-DECORATION: none; line-height:14px;}
.texte_on {FONT-SIZE: 10pt; COLOR: #FFFF00; FONT-FAMILY: Verdana; TEXT-DECORATION: none; line-height:14px;}

.modele {FONT-SIZE: 10pt; COLOR: #FF0000; FONT-FAMILY: Verdana; TEXT-DECORATION: overline; line-height: 15px;font-weight:bold;}
A.modele:hover {FONT-SIZE: 12pt; COLOR: #FF0000; FONT-FAMILY: Verdana; TEXT-DECORATION: overline; line-height: 15px;font-weight:bold;}

.texte2 {FONT-SIZE: 10pt; COLOR: #990000; FONT-FAMILY: Verdana; TEXT-DECORATION: none; line-height: 15px;}
.texte3 {FONT-SIZE: 11pt; COLOR: #990000; FONT-FAMILY: Verdana; TEXT-DECORATION: none; line-height: 17px; background-color:#D1CBB4;}

H1 {FONT-SIZE: 16pt; COLOR: #990000; FONT-FAMILY: Verdana; line-height: 15px;}
h2 {FONT-SIZE: 16pt; COLOR: #000000; FONT-FAMILY: Verdana; line-height: 18px;}
h3 {FONT-SIZE: 12pt; COLOR: #990000; FONT-FAMILY: Verdana; line-height: 15px;}

TX {FONT-SIZE: 10pt; COLOR: #FF0000; FONT-FAMILY: Verdana; line-height: 17px;}

.titre2 {FONT-SIZE: 10pt; COLOR: #000000; FONT-FAMILY: Verdana; TEXT-DECORATION: none; line-height: 15px;}



.num {FONT-SIZE:8pt;COLOR:#990000;FONT-FAMILY:Verdana;TEXT-DECORATION:none;line-height:10px;font-weight:bold;}
A.num:hover {FONT-SIZE:8pt;COLOR:#FFFFFF;FONT-FAMILY:Verdana;TEXT-DECORATION:none;line-height:10px;font-weight:bold;}

.num_on {FONT-SIZE:8pt;COLOR:#FF0000;FONT-FAMILY:Verdana;TEXT-DECORATION:none;line-height:10px;font-weight:bold;}
A.num_on:hover {FONT-SIZE:8pt;COLOR:#FF0000;FONT-FAMILY:Verdana;TEXT-DECORATION:none;line-height:10px;font-weight:bold;}

.souris {cursor: hand;}

.menu {FONT-SIZE: 9pt; COLOR: #FF9900; FONT-FAMILY: Verdana; TEXT-DECORATION: none; line-height: 15px;}
A.menu:hover {BACKGROUND: #CCCCFF; COLOR: #000066; line-height: 15px;}

.navigrapid {FONT-SIZE: 12pt; COLOR: #FFFFFF; FONT-FAMILY: Verdana; TEXT-DECORATION: none;}
A.navigrapid:hover {FONT-SIZE: 12pt; COLOR: #FFFF00; FONT-FAMILY: Verdana; TEXT-DECORATION: none;}

.navigbas {FONT-SIZE: 7pt; COLOR: #999999; FONT-FAMILY: Verdana; TEXT-DECORATION: none;}
A.navigbas:hover {FONT-SIZE: 7pt; COLOR: #FFFF00; FONT-FAMILY: Verdana; TEXT-DECORATION: none;}

.calque1 {scrollbar-face-color: #666666 ; scrollbar-shadow-color: #CCCCCC;
scrollbar-highlight-color: #CCCCCC ; scrollbar-3dlight-color: #CCCCCC; scrollbar-darkshadow-color: #CCCCCC; scrollbar-track-color: #CCCCCC; scrollbar-arrow-color: #CCCCCC}

.retrait {
	clip:   rect(auto auto auto auto);
	margin: 6px;
}

.descript {FONT-SIZE: 11pt; COLOR: #FFFFFF; FONT-FAMILY: Verdana;}
.navigrapid {FONT-SIZE: 12pt; COLOR: #D2CCB5; FONT-FAMILY: Verdana;}

.cel_titre {background-color: #000000;}
.cel_haut {background-color: #FFFFFF;}
.cel_bas {background-color: #B8B3A5;}
.titre2 {FONT-SIZE: 10pt; COLOR: #990000; FONT-FAMILY: Verdana; TEXT-DECORATION: none;font-weight:bold;}
.titre1 {FONT-SIZE: 11pt; COLOR: #99948E; FONT-FAMILY: Verdana; TEXT-DECORATION: none;font-weight:bold;}
.descr2 {FONT-SIZE: 10pt; COLOR: #990000; FONT-FAMILY: Verdana; TEXT-DECORATION:}

.form_button {FONT-SIZE: 15pt; COLOR: #002B00; FONT-FAMILY: Verdana; BACKGROUND-COLOR: #D1CBB4; TEXT-DECORATION: none; border-color: #D1CBB4}
.form1 {FONT-SIZE: 9pt; COLOR: #19607E; FONT-FAMILY: Verdana; BACKGROUND-COLOR: #DEDAC9; TEXT-DECORATION: none; border-color: #D1CBB4}
.form {FONT-SIZE: 9pt; COLOR: #D1CBB4; FONT-FAMILY: Verdana; BACKGROUND-COLOR: #19607E; TEXT-DECORATION: none; border-right-color: #E69F81; border-left-color: #E69F81; border-top-color: #E69F81; border-bottom-color: #E69F81;}

div#contact{z-index:1; position:fixed; text-align:left; top:20px; left:0px; width:160px; height:45; margin:0; padding:3px; background-color:#000000; display:block;filter:alpha(opacity=70);-moz-opacity:0.7;-khtml-opacity:0.7;opacity:0.7}
div#contact{position:absolute; top:expression(documentElement.scrollTop+body.scrollTop+20+"px");}
div#contact{text-align:-moz-left}
html>body div#contact{position:fixed}
html[xmlns] div#contact{position:fixed}

.email {FONT-SIZE: 7pt; COLOR: #009900; FONT-FAMILY: Verdana; TEXT-DECORATION: none;font-weight:;}

.transp{filter:alpha(opacity=90);-moz-opacity:0.9;-khtml-opacity:0.9;opacity:0.9}

.Fond_Motr_Goog{background-image:url(../images/fondsearch.gif);background-repeat:no-repeat}
.Fond_H{background-image:url(../images/fond_haut.jpg);background-repeat:no-repeat}

